Conventional Slotting
• Full slotting limitations:
— Usually not more then ap = 1 x D.
— Conventional and climb milling at the same time.
— High heat development on the tool and on the workpiece.
— Diffi cult chip evacuation.
— High radial forces.
• This means:
— No constant chip thickness.
— Low MRR.
— Surface quality from the left to right side are different.
— Limited tool life.
— High power and torque requirements for the machine.
